Thermal self-interaction of electromagnetic radiation in a medium with an overheating instability
N. A. Blinov, V. N. Zolotkov, A. Yu. Lezin, V. P. Sinel'nikov, N. V. Cheburkin
Abstract:
A theoretical investigation is made of the stability of a plane electromagnetic wave traversing a plasma of a non-self-sustained discharge in a relaxing gas. It is shown that an overheating instability of the plasma leads to an absolute instability of an electromagnetic wave in the presence of small-scale perturbations. The angular distribution of the instability increment is obtained. Its anisotropy is attributed to a transverse (relative to an electric field) nature of the overheating instability.
